BMW:
A German multinational corporation named BMW which first started with the production of aircraft engines and later got into creating luxury vehicles and motorcycles logos has a unique story of how their logo was made.
Their symbol was believed to be of a white and blue checkered plane propeller but in actual is from the flag of the Bavarian Free State with colours reversed making it resemble a propeller. This makes people know they will be receiving something amazing.

Vaio:
If you are interested in technology you for sure have heard about the brand named Vaio, a company launched by Sony selling laptop which hasn’t been bought a lot because of their cost and quality of the product the customer receives.
Let’s forget about the brand the logo of Vaio which is short for visual audio intelligent organizer has a beautifully designed symbol in which is designed with the letter ‘va’ made up of analog waves and the letters ‘io’ resembles number 1 and 0.

Baskin Robbins:
Baskin Robbin is a chain of shops offering ice-cream and cakes has something unique about its restaurants which is its flavour as it offers 31 different flavours one can try from. All these different offers are what makes this brand unique from all the others.
This hidden item in their logo is the number 31 which can be seen in the curve of the letter B and the stem of R. With that the colour they use is the cotton candy colour which represents fun and energy.

Tour de France:
Tour de France is a multistage annual men’s multiple stage bicycle race that consists of different stages making it 21 days long which is held for 23 days. It is a tour of France and other nearby countries.
This logo design of this consists of two hidden meaning the first one is the circle with a dot which resembles a bicycle wheel and the letter r which can be seen in the end resembles a cyclist which is what the race is all about.
